Transaction 84641eddc9e94c4ff9517f25b2faeb532cc8d71b56d5130e2354e7a90b793504

1 Input
2 Outputs
  • 84641eddc9e94c4ff9517f25b2faeb532cc8d71b56d5130e2354e7a90b793504:0
  • value  6288683
    address  34fPXWvZ2Sh7kxVgS4Lyz8FFmBCtSML1iD
  • 84641eddc9e94c4ff9517f25b2faeb532cc8d71b56d5130e2354e7a90b793504:1
  • value  482504
    address  3LqmadbGBSXiwoDRstSLTvptHxYpVh1Tzy